Job Summary

Overview

AMERICAN SYSTEMS is one of the largestemployee-ownedcompanies in the United States supportingnational priority programsin defense intelligence and homeland security. As an employee-owner youll contribute directly to mission success while growing your own stake in the companys future.

As an on-site AMERICAN SYSTEMSLead Network Engineer youll take a hands-on leadership role ensuring secure reliable network operations supporting U.S. Government customers. Youll serve as a technical authority guiding network design troubleshooting complex issues and maintaining mission-critical connectivity in classified environments.

Responsibilities

As a Lead Network Engineer you will:

  • Configure and troubleshootCisco Identity Services Engine (ISE)to protect data and control access to classified networks.
  • Install configure and maintainCisco routers switches and firewalls.
  • Diagnose and resolveLayer 2/Layer 3VPN andVMwarenetwork issues.
  • Coordinate on-site and remotely with users to configure equipment and troubleshoot connectivity.
  • Recommend performance and security enhancements that improve reliability and reduce costs.
  • Interface with senior management and vendor technical teams on network solutions.
  • Work independently or lead small technical efforts with minimal supervision.

Qualifications

What You Bring:

  • U.S. Citizenship(required)
  • Active TOP SECRET clearancewithSCI eligibility
  • Bachelors degree(or 6 additional years of relevant experience in lieu of degree)
  • 810 yearsof professional networking experience
  • Expertise inCisco ISE configuration and troubleshootingrouting/switching andfirewall administration
  • Strong understanding ofLayer 2/3 protocolsand network design principles
  • Certifications such asCCNPorCCIEare highly preferred
